Anti-Demineralization Effects of Dental Adhesive-Composites on Enamel-Root Dentin Junction

Polymers (Basel). 2021 Sep 29;13(19):3327. doi: 10.3390/polym13193327. ABSTRACT Oral biofilm reactor (OBR) and pH cycling (pHC) artificial caries model were employed to evaluate the anti-demineralization effects of four composite filling systems on enamel-root dentin junction.
